Medical radiographic imaging method for measuring 3D bone density distributions, in which 3D radiological data are processed in conjunction with a 3D generic model of a bone being imaged

Medical radiographic imaging method in which the density of bones is measured by determination of the value of a composite index in a 3D coordinate system based on digitized radiological data and a 3D generic model of a bone structure being imaged. Independent claims are also included for the following:- (a) a device for measuring the 3D spatial distribution of bone density and; (b) a computer program for processing digital radiographic data to determine bone density distributions.
